A small step "Together"

It had all began with a rather morbid news, that a 4 year old was sexually assaulted. I was not too surprised that it happened, to be honest. I was shocked, rather, to imagine how many must be happening behind the curtain, unnoticed, unreported, unacknowledged just so that one piece among them could surface up to grab half a column on the daily news. The groups on social media were flooding with demands and disputes around school's intervention in matters of CCTV, female attendant, while I was cringing to think how the 4 year old never came back home to tell it to her mother, because she was either scared or didn't even know it was wrong...

I had put forward an outcry which was more at spur of moment than was purposeful. I had asked if we could arrange a workshop to tell kids and parents what they should know! But they gave me hope, and shoulders. The enthusiasm since last week was absolutely heartening. What was just a musing became an idea, and then a purpose. We formed a team, and we named ourselves "Together". We stole our kids crayon boxes and made posters while they were away at school. We painted the mailboxes and WhatsApp groups red...
